Author |
|
Dmitry Newbie
Joined: 12 November 2009 Location: Ukraine
Online Status: Offline Posts: 4
|
Posted: 12 November 2009 at 4:16am | IP Logged
|
|
|
Hello,
In my application I use MailBee.NET POP3 component. And when I trying to receive emails from my email box I get following exception:
MailBee.MailBeeInvalidTextResponseException: The particular item of the response data cannot be parsed. The response string: NTENT-TYPE:. ---> bw: The particular item of the response data cannot be parsed.
at c1.a(String A_0, Encoding A_1)
at p.a(Int32 A_0)
--- End of inner exception stack trace ---
at p.a(Int32 A_0)
at b5.ak()
at ar.a(Int32 A_0, Int32 A_1, Int32 A_2)
at a4.a(Int32 A_0, Int32 A_1, Int32 A_2)
at a4.a(Boolean A_0, Int32 A_1, Int32 A_2, Int32 A_3)
at MailBee.Pop3Mail.Pop3.DownloadEntireMessages()
Log of MailBee.NET:
[15:22:15.23] [INFO] Assembly version: 5.0.2.133.
[15:22:15.23] [INFO] Will resolve host "mail.lviv.ua".
[15:22:15.23] [INFO] Host "mail.lviv.ua" resolved to IP address(es) 194.44.214.39.
[15:22:15.23] [INFO] Will connect to host "mail.lviv.ua" on port 110.
[15:22:15.23] [INFO] Socket connected to IP address 194.44.214.39 on port 110.
[15:22:15.39] [RECV] +OK Imap ready.\r\n
[15:22:15.39] [INFO] Connected to mail service at host "mail.lviv.ua" on port 110 and ready.
[15:22:15.39] [INFO] Get the list of POP3 capabilities via CAPA command.
[15:22:15.39] [SEND] CAPA\r\n
[15:22:15.46] [RECV] +OK\r\nCAPA\r\nTOP\r\nUIDL\r\nRESP-CODES\r\nPIPELINING\r\nST LS\r\nUSER\r\nSASL PLAIN\r\n.\r\n
[15:22:15.46] [INFO] Will login as "crystal".
[15:22:15.46] [INFO] Will try regular USER/PASS authentication.
[15:22:15.46] [SEND] USER crystal\r\n
[15:22:15.54] [RECV] +OK\r\n
[15:22:15.54] [SEND] PASS ********\r\n
[15:22:15.62] [RECV] +OK Logged in.\r\n
[15:22:15.62] [INFO] Logged in as "crystal".
[15:22:15.62] [INFO] Download inbox statistics.
[15:22:15.62] [SEND] STAT\r\n
[15:22:15.70] [RECV] +OK 3 22211\r\n
[15:22:15.70] [INFO] Will download entire messages (startIndex=1, count=3).
[15:22:15.70] [SEND] RETR 1\r\n
[15:22:15.70] [SEND] RETR 2\r\n
[15:22:15.70] [SEND] RETR 3\r\n
[15:22:15.96] [RECV] +OK 6847 octets\r\n [Total 6909 bytes received.]
[15:22:16.06] [INFO] Error: The particular item of the response data cannot be parsed. The response string: NTENT-TYPE:.
[15:22:16.07] [INFO] Will disconnect from host "mail.lviv.ua".
[15:22:16.07] [INFO] Disconnected from host "mail.lviv.ua".
In what could be the problem?
Thanks
|
Back to Top |
|
|
Igor AfterLogic Support
Joined: 24 June 2008 Location: United States
Online Status: Offline Posts: 6103
|
Posted: 12 November 2009 at 4:28am | IP Logged
|
|
|
Looks like you're using an outdated version of MailBee.NET.dll, please try the latest version available at:
.NET 1.1 and above
.NET 2.0 and above
(upgrading instructions can be found here)
In case if the issue persist, please submit the logs generated by the latest version of MailBee.NET Objects.
--
Regards,
Igor, AfterLogic Support
|
Back to Top |
|
|
Dmitry Newbie
Joined: 12 November 2009 Location: Ukraine
Online Status: Offline Posts: 4
|
Posted: 25 November 2009 at 6:08am | IP Logged
|
|
|
Hello,
I try to use the latest version of the MailBee.NET.dll (5.7.2.169) as you recommended. But I get the same exception again :(
Log of MailBee.NET:
[12:56:44.51] [INFO] Assembly version: 5.7.2.169.
[12:56:44.50] [INFO] Will resolve host "mail.2upost.com".
[12:56:45.09] [INFO] Host "mail.2upost.com" resolved to IP address(es) 193.0.240.37.
[12:56:45.12] [INFO] Will connect to host "mail.2upost.com" on port 110.
[12:56:45.21] [INFO] Socket connected to IP address 193.0.240.37 on port 110.
[12:56:45.31] [RECV] +OK Hello there.\r\n
[12:56:45.32] [INFO] Connected to mail service at host "mail.2upost.com" on port 110 and ready.
[12:56:45.37] [INFO] Get the list of POP3 capabilities via CAPA command.
[12:56:45.40] [SEND] CAPA\r\n
[12:56:45.40] [RECV] +OK Here's what I can do:\r\nSASL PLAIN LOGIN CRAM-SHA1 CRAM-SHA256\r\nSTLS\r\nTOP\r\nUSER\r\nLOGIN-DELAY 10\r\nPIPELINING\r\nUIDL\r\nIMPLEMENTATION Courier Mail Server\r\n.\r\n
[12:56:45.45] [INFO] Will login as "zvit_masterkey@mclaut.in.ua".
[12:56:45.48] [INFO] Will try regular USER/PASS authentication.
[12:56:45.48] [SEND] USER zvit_masterkey@mclaut.in.ua\r\n
[12:56:45.48] [RECV] +OK Password required.\r\n
[12:56:45.50] [SEND] PASS ********\r\n
[12:56:45.51] [RECV] +OK logged in.\r\n
[12:56:45.53] [INFO] Logged in as "zvit_masterkey@mclaut.in.ua".
[12:56:45.53] [INFO] Download inbox statistics.
[12:56:45.53] [SEND] STAT\r\n
[12:56:45.57] [RECV] +OK 18 135272\r\n
[12:56:45.57] [INFO] Will download entire messages (startIndex=1, count=18).
[12:56:45.60] [SEND] RETR 1\r\n
[12:56:45.60] [SEND] RETR 2\r\n
[12:56:45.60] [SEND] RETR 3\r\n
[12:56:45.60] [SEND] RETR 4\r\n
[12:56:45.64] [SEND] RETR 5\r\n
[12:56:45.64] [SEND] RETR 6\r\n
[12:56:45.64] [SEND] RETR 7\r\n
[12:56:45.64] [SEND] RETR 8\r\n
[12:56:45.64] [SEND] RETR 9\r\n
[12:56:45.64] [SEND] RETR 10\r\n
[12:56:45.64] [SEND] RETR 11\r\n
[12:56:45.64] [SEND] RETR 12\r\n
[12:56:45.65] [SEND] RETR 13\r\n
[12:56:45.65] [SEND] RETR 14\r\n
[12:56:45.65] [SEND] RETR 15\r\n
[12:56:45.68] [SEND] RETR 16\r\n
[12:56:45.68] [SEND] RETR 17\r\n
[12:56:45.68] [SEND] RETR 18\r\n
[12:56:45.73] [RECV] +OK 918 octets follow.\r\n [Total 945 bytes received.]
[12:56:45.92] [INFO] Error: The particular item of the response data cannot be parsed. The response string: .GOV.UA>.
[12:56:45.98] [INFO] Will disconnect from host "mail.2upost.com".
[12:56:45.98] [INFO] Disconnected from host "mail.2upost.com".
Thanks.
|
Back to Top |
|
|
Igor AfterLogic Support
Joined: 24 June 2008 Location: United States
Online Status: Offline Posts: 6103
|
Posted: 25 November 2009 at 6:28am | IP Logged
|
|
|
To let us help you on this, please provide us with a test account we could use to reproduce the issue.
Most probably, the issue is caused by pipelining feature in effect, and turning it off may eliminate the issue; check this documentation page for details on this. This issue does not arise with other mailers like Outlook Express as they don't utilise pipelining, but be aware that turning pipelining off may cause degraded performance.
--
Regards,
Igor, AfterLogic Support
|
Back to Top |
|
|
TLG Newbie
Joined: 21 March 2012 Location: Mongolia
Online Status: Offline Posts: 1
|
Posted: 21 March 2012 at 3:24am | IP Logged
|
|
|
Hello, I`m using old version of Mailbee. It`s working fine until this error occurs. Do I have to try the newest version ? Thank you.
[19:10:07.06] [INFO] Assembly version: 5.6.2.146.
[19:10:07.06] [INFO] Will perform POP-before-SMTP authentication.
[19:10:07.06] [INFO] Will resolve host "host_name".
[19:10:07.06] [INFO] Host "host_name" resolved to IP address(es) IP_ADDRESS.
[19:10:07.06] [INFO] Will connect to host "host_name" on port 25.
[19:10:07.33] [INFO] Socket connected to IP address IP_ADDRESS on port 25.
[19:10:07.62] [INFO] Will disconnect from host "host_name".
[19:10:07.62] [INFO] Disconnected from host "host_name".
[19:10:07.62] [INFO] Error: The particular item of the response data cannot be parsed. The response string: 220.
|
Back to Top |
|
|
Igor AfterLogic Support
Joined: 24 June 2008 Location: United States
Online Status: Offline Posts: 6103
|
Posted: 21 March 2012 at 3:34am | IP Logged
|
|
|
While that might be a problem of particular DLL build, and trying the latest version might help indeed, the error message states there's a problem on mail server level. If the issue persists with the latest version, please let us know, and be sure to check your valid maintenance status first.
--
Regards,
Igor, AfterLogic Support
|
Back to Top |
|
|
rayann Newbie
Joined: 17 September 2013 Location: Iran
Online Status: Offline Posts: 3
|
Posted: 17 September 2013 at 11:25pm | IP Logged
|
|
|
hello
I use MailBee.NET POP3 component.
I recived emails with my webmail but I have problem downloading emails with MailBee.Pop3Mail.Pop3.QuickDownloadMessage and I receive this error:"The server has responded with negative reply. The server responded: -ERR authorization failed."
Log of MailBee.NET:
[10:51:00.55] [INFO] Assembly version: 7.0.2.328.
[10:51:00.50] [INFO] Will resolve host "...".
[10:51:00.57] [INFO] Host "..." resolved to IP address(es) ....
[10:51:00.58] [INFO] Will connect to host "..." on port ....
[10:51:00.64] [INFO] Socket connected to IP address ... on port ....
[10:51:01.54] [RECV] +OK <...>\r\n
[10:51:01.59] [INFO] Connected to mail service at host "..." on port ... and ready.
[10:51:04.57] [INFO] Get the list of POP3 capabilities via CAPA command.
[10:51:04.58] [SEND] CAPA\r\n
[10:51:05.12] [RECV] -ERR authorization first\r\n
[10:51:05.14] [INFO] Warning: The server does not support CAPA command. POP3 pipelining will not be available. The server responded: -ERR authorization first.
[10:51:05.18] [INFO] Get the list of advertized SASL authentication methods via AUTH command.
[10:51:05.19] [SEND] AUTH\r\n
[10:51:05.76] [RECV] -ERR authorization first\r\n
[10:51:05.79] [INFO] Warning: The server does not support AUTH command. SASL authentication will not be available. The server responded: -ERR authorization first.
[10:51:05.80] [INFO] Will login as "....".
[10:51:05.81] [INFO] Will try regular USER/PASS authentication.
[10:51:05.82] [SEND] USER ....\r\n
[10:51:06.44] [RECV] +OK \r\n
[10:51:06.44] [SEND] PASS ********\r\n
[10:51:07.04] [RECV] +OK \r\n
[10:51:07.05] [INFO] Logged in as "....".
[10:51:07.06] [INFO] Download inbox statistics.
[10:51:07.07] [SEND] STAT\r\n
[10:51:07.67] [RECV] +OK 6 22070\r\n
[10:51:11.51] [INFO] Download the list of Unique-IDs of all messages in inbox.
[10:51:11.52] [SEND] UIDL\r\n
[10:51:12.33] [RECV] +OK \r\n1 1379326622.3133.HOSTING-LinuxHC,S=1286\r\n2 1379342886.239 ... TING-LinuxHC,S=4886\r\n6 1379432989.583.HOSTING-LinuxHC,S=930\r\n.\r\n [Total 260 bytes received.]
|
Back to Top |
|
|
Igor AfterLogic Support
Joined: 24 June 2008 Location: United States
Online Status: Offline Posts: 6103
|
Posted: 17 September 2013 at 11:39pm | IP Logged
|
|
|
Strangely enough, the log extract doesn't contain "-ERR authorization failed", so it's probably different session logged. Anyway, MailBee attempts to use most secure authentication methods first, but this particular server seems to handle regular authentication only. Try using that one explicitly for Pop3.Login - or, alternately, use AuthenticationOptions.PreferSimpleMethods there. Advanced configuration like that one won't work with QuickDownloadMessage method though, you'll need something like DownloadEntireMessage instead.
By the way, you're using quite an old DLL build, you can download current one for .NET Framework 2.0 or above, there's also build for .NET Framework 4.0 or above.
--
Regards,
Igor, AfterLogic Support
|
Back to Top |
|
|
rayann Newbie
Joined: 17 September 2013 Location: Iran
Online Status: Offline Posts: 3
|
Posted: 18 September 2013 at 2:03am | IP Logged
|
|
|
Thank you, my problem was resolved.
Can I download emails from multiple mailbox with Pop3?
|
Back to Top |
|
|
Igor AfterLogic Support
Joined: 24 June 2008 Location: United States
Online Status: Offline Posts: 6103
|
Posted: 18 September 2013 at 2:06am | IP Logged
|
|
|
Sure, but if you want to do that simultaneously, you'd need to create multiple Pop3 object instances and probably put them to separate threads.
--
Regards,
Igor, AfterLogic Support
|
Back to Top |
|
|